Maintenance

Belt Replacement

1. Disconnect the power to the machine to prevent acci-
dental start-ups. If the machine is plugged into an outlet,
unplug it. If the machine is hardwired to a branch circuit
with a junction box, remove the fuse or trip the circuit breaker
to the branch.
2. Remove the lock knob and top cover (See Figure 6).
3. Remove the side guard and table.
4. Release the belt tension by turning the tension handle
in a counterclockwise direction (See Figure 7). If the handle
is difficult to turn, perform Track Mechanism Maintenance
according to the instructions following this section.
5. Remove the belt.
6. Check the drums and platen for scoring or signs of
wear which might require service or replacement.
7. Check the height of the platen with a straight edge. If it
is not 1/32 in. above the drums, adjust it according to the
instructions in Platen Replacement or Adjustment in the
Machine Setup section of this manual.
8. Check the drums for looseness which might cause
tracking problems. Correct any loose condition by tighten-
ing or replacing any parts as required.
9. Slip the new belt onto the drums and platen.
10. Adjust the tension handle clockwise until the belt is flat
against the platen and there is no curling or buckling of the
belt in the middle.
11. Turn the drums by hand to see if the belt tracks more-
or-less true. JUST BECAUSE THE OLD BELT TRACKED
CORRECTLY DOES NOT MEAN THE NEW BELT WILL.
Always check the tracking when replacing a belt.
12. To adjust the tracking:

12.1. Plug the machine back into the outlet or
reestablish power in the branch.
12.2. Loosen the tracking lock knob.
12.3. Jog the motor on and off as necessary to
observe the tracking, and turn the tracking knob as
necessary to make the belt track in the center of the
platen and drums. Turn the tracking knob clockwise to
move the belt toward the right and counterclockwise to
move the belt toward the left.
12.4. When the belt seems to be tracking correctly, turn
the motor on and leave it running while fine tuning the
tracking.
12.5. Lock the tracking lock knob.
12.6. When the lock knob is secure, turn the power
off and disconnect the machine from the outlet or
branch as in Step 1, above.
13. Replace the table, side guard, top cover and lock
knob by reversing steps 3 and 2, above.
14. If you have not already done so, reconnect the power
to the machine and return it to service.
